#0d0a61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d0a61 is composed of 5.1% red, 3.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 21%. #0d0a61 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a14c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#0d0a61 color description : Very dark blue.
#0d0a61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d0a61 has RGB values of R:13, G:10,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 854625.

Shades and Tints of #0d0a61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f6f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d0a61
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333338 is the less saturated color, while #050269 is the most saturated one.
